Instant Pot Skinny Fettuccine Alfredo

Prep Time 5 minutes mins
Cook Time 20 minutes mins
Total Time 25 minutes mins
Servings 4
Calories 405 kcal
- 8 ounces fettuccine noodles broken in half
- 1 teaspoon oil
- 3 cloves garlic minced
- salt and pepper to taste
- 2.5 cups low-sodium chicken broth or vegetable broth
- 1 cup milk skim or 1%
- 3 teaspoons cornstarch
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on dried basil
- 1/2 teaspoon dried parsley flakes
- 1 cup parmesan cheese freshly grated
Add oil to the IP and turn to saute. Once hot add garlic and stir for 10 seconds. Turn IP off.
Add pasta and chicken broth, making sure the noodles are covered in the liquid.
Turn valve to sealed and cook on manual (high pressure) for 3 minutes. When the times beeps allow the pressure to naturally release for 6 minutes, before turning the valve to release remaining pressure and open the lid.
Stir pasta, breaking up any pieces that have stuck together.
Stir the cornstarch and milk together until smooth. Add to the instant pot, along with the dry spices and parmesan cheese. Season with salt and pepper, to taste.
Turn Instant pot to saute setting and stir gently until the sauce just begins to thicken. Turn Instant Pot off.
The sauce will thicken significantly as it cools, so allow it to cool for a few minutes before serving. You can add additional cheese, if needed, to thicken the sauce.
